推荐开源项目:Vue-Dplayer - 轻量级且功能强大的Vue.js视频播放器
去发现同类优质开源项目:https://gitcode.com/
**** 是一款基于DPlayer并专门为Vue.js框架定制的视频播放器组件。它不仅继承了DPlayer的优秀特性,还针对Vue.js的开发习惯进行了优化,旨在提供一种简单、高效的方式来在你的Vue项目中集成视频播放功能。
技术分析
Vue-Dplayer 使用原生HTML5 <video>
标签作为基础,结合WebMVC和H.264编码方式,支持多种视频源格式(如MP4、WebM、FLV等)。此外,它还利用WebAssembly和WebGL技术提供了硬件加速的流畅播放体验。
该组件以Vue 2.x 和 Vue 3.x 兼容为目标,采用单文件组件(SFC)模式编写,使得代码结构清晰,易于理解和维护。通过props
和emits
,开发者可以轻松地控制播放状态、配置播放器设置、监听播放事件等。
Vue-Dplayer 还集成了弹幕功能,支持Danmaku(弹幕)协议,可以创建互动性强的视频体验。除此之外,它提供了丰富的自定义皮肤和插件机制,让个性化定制变得轻松愉快。
应用场景
Vue-Dplayer 可广泛应用于各种需要在线视频播放的场合:
- 视频分享网站或博客,为用户提供直观的内容展示。
- 在线教育平台,用于直播教学或录播课程。
- 游戏直播平台,结合弹幕功能实现观众互动。
- 新闻资讯类应用,用于报道中的动态视频展示。
特点
- 轻量级:小巧的体积,快速加载,不影响页面性能。
- 高度可定制:丰富的配置项和API接口,满足不同需求。
- Vue友好:与Vue.js设计理念无缝对接,易于集成。
- 跨平台兼容:支持主流浏览器及移动设备。
- 弹幕系统:内置Danmaku功能,增强用户体验。
- 模块化设计:方便扩展和维护,可添加自定义插件。
结语
Vue-Dplayer 是一款专为Vue.js生态打造的高质量视频播放解决方案。其简洁的API、全面的功能以及良好的社区支持,使其成为开发者在构建视频相关项目时的理想选择。如果你正在寻找一个高效、易用且功能丰富的视频播放器组件,不妨尝试一下Vue-Dplayer,相信它会给你的项目带来惊喜。
立即访问,开始探索Vue-Dplayer的强大之处吧!
去发现同类优质开源项目:https://gitcode.com/